Transaction 101f52c3c593aaaf4dc7f4e39ae0b20607347274af5e73dbb3c12dd543bedf47

8 Input
2 Outputs
  • 101f52c3c593aaaf4dc7f4e39ae0b20607347274af5e73dbb3c12dd543bedf47:0
  • value  41924
    address  18weiEJAGX7FdrQiyJr9J9xuPR7mFWwei
  • 101f52c3c593aaaf4dc7f4e39ae0b20607347274af5e73dbb3c12dd543bedf47:1
  • value  1442000
    address  3HsAWo115Mo7JgjprHXQ1DcMD3tg1VGa8a